Assault Lily: New Chapter 2, subtitled Twilight of the Flowers / The Ringing Depths (アサルトリリィ・新章 第2弾 花々の黄昏/玲瓏たる深潭) is a stage play created by AZONE International and acus. It is the sequel to Assault Lily: New Chapter, and the thirteenth stage play in the Assault Lily franchise.
The stage play ran from May 17, 2024 to May 22, 2024 at the Kameari Lirio Hall. It tells two stories simultaneously, one (Twilight of the Flowers) focused on Legion Sanngriðr, the other (The Ringing Depths) about an "Oshima Offshore Nest Investigation Team" made up of a variety of Lilies from many Gardens.
A sequel, Assault Lily Sturm, ran in April 2025.
Summary
Following the events of Assault Lily: New Chapter, Legions Álfheimr, Sanngriðr, and the Survey Team have continued to fight fiercely against the Huge on Oshima Island. Legion Sanngriðr is still facing relentless attacks by the Flowers of the End, and during one clash with them, Touka discovers a clue as to who the Flowers really are. However, there's no time to solve the mystery. The Lilies haven't been able to destroy any of the Nests surrounding the island; with the Nests still growing, it isn't long before Oshima is enveloped in the Death Zone that they feared would arise.
Sanngriðr and the Survey Team embark upon a desperate attempt to destroy the Death Zone before it becomes impossible to fight within it. After dealing with a variety of threats both familiar and new, the two teams find themselves battling Rusalka, the humanoid Huge, together. Misaka's newly discovered rare skill has kept the exhausted Lilies on their feet, but they realize mid-Neunwelt that they won't be able to defeat Rusalka without making sacrifices. It's at that moment that they receive help from a wholly unexpected place...
Plot
Prologue
The play opens with a mysterious, dreamlike scene narrated by Hasebe Touka. She reminisces about the time when, at the Odaiba Counteroffensive one year ago, her roommate Kondo Misaka saved countless lives and inspired countless Lilies by dueling a Gigant-type alone for over twenty minutes. Ever since then, Misaka has always been there for her, and hasn't she been there for Misaka? No sooner has Touka had that thought than Yamaguchi Chihiro appears, clutching Misaka possessively to her as she quotes an ancient love poem. As Chihiro guides her offstage, Misaka glances helplessly back at Touka, and Touka screams that Misaka is hers and she won't give her to Chihiro. The lights then fade to black, and the reverie ends.
Misaka places a phone call to Mashima Moyu back at Yurigaoka, telling her all about Chihiro and the Flowers of the End. She tells Moyu that she wants to save the Flowers, but Moyu reminds her that the reason Sanngriðr is on Oshima is to destroy the Nests surrounding the island and eliminate the risk of a Death Zone forming. Moyu was previously invited to become a member of Legion Sanngriðr by Touka and Luise Ingels; she spontaneously decides to accept the invitation and join Sanngriðr's reserve members, Tetsukawa Toa and Nagasaka Maho, as they fly to Oshima.
After welcoming Moyu to the legion, Misaka explains the recent situation on Oshima. Legions Álfheimr and Sanngriðr teamed up to destroy the Senba Shallows Nest, but were interrupted by the unexpected arrival of Charybdis—one of the Seven Great Ultras—and a mysterious Huge who's even more humanoid than the juggernauts were. The two legions joined forces with the Survey Team to drive Charybdis and its companion away, in a story that was told elsewhere.

Trivia
- The plot of New Chapter 2 is closely tied to the main story of Assault Lily: Last Bullet in many ways:
- The arrival of Legion Álfheimr on Oshima was depicted in Last Bullet.
- Charybdis and Rusalka first appeared in Last Bullet's main story a few months before New Chapter 2's theatrical run.
- Several parts of the Last Bullet story take place simultaneously with New Chapter 2, and a few scenes are depicted in both the play and in Last Bullet, with identical or near-identical dialogue.
- One part of the Last Bullet story depicts the events which, just prior to Legion Sanngriðr's departure to Oshima, convinced Hibari to take the Schutzengel's Oath with Fumi.
- One part of the Last Bullet story centers upon Kagawa Makina's reaction to discovering that Ayame and Motoko survived Kuramayama Labs.
